The overview below groups typical Barn Roof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Seattle, WA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or barn roof repairs, such as patching leaks or replacing a few shingles, gener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ine maintenance jobs fall within this range, depending on the extent of the work needed.
Partial Roof Replacement - Replacing a section of a barn roof or upgrading damaged areas usually costs between $1,200 and $3,500. Larger, more complex projects can push beyond this range, but most projects are completed within these bounds.
Full Roof Replacement - Complete barn roof replacements tend to fall between $4,000 and $8,000, with many local contractors providing estimates in this range for standard-sized structures. Projects with additional features or higher-end materials may cost more.
Large or Complex Projects - Extensive or highly customized barn roof installations can exceed $10,000, though such projects are less common. Local service providers can help determine the precise costs based on the scope and materials involved.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of installing a new barn roof? A new barn roof can improve the structure’s durability, provide better protection from the elements, and enhance the overall appearance of the barn.
How do local contractors determine the best roofing materials for a barn? They assess factors such as climate, barn usage, and existing structure to recommend suitable roofing options that ensure longevity and performance.
Can existing barn roofs be repaired instead of replaced? Yes, many issues can be addressed through repairs, but a professional evaluation can determine if replacement is more effective for long-term stability.
What types of roofing materials are commonly used for barn roofs? Common materials include metal panels, asphalt shingles, and wood shakes, each offering different benefits depending on the barn’s needs.
